I learned yesterday that I need to go above and beyond for the cause of Christ. Yes, I have been called to be the teacher sponsor of The Chill and to lead a small group at FUSE. But, how about other things that I could do to further the kingdom? I have been guilty in the past of saying that I am only going to do what God calls me to do, but that was almost always an excuse to be lazy in some way. God hit me with something in 1 Samuel 18:24-26.

"When Saul's men reported this back to the king, he told them 'Tell David that all I want for the bride price is 100 Philistine foreskins! Vengeance on my enemies is all I really want.' But what Saul had in mind was that David would be killed in the fight. David was delighted to accept the offer. Before the time limit expired, he and his men went out and killed 200 Philistines. Then David fulfilled the king's requirement by presenting all their foreskins to him."

1 Samuel 18:24-26 (NLT)

The king asked David (a man after God's own heart) to bring him 100 foreskins, which is a pretty gross request, but David brought him 200! God spoke to my heart and said "why are you only bringing me 100 when you could bring me 200?" Wow...such a weird passage for such a strong conviction from God!

So...after that I had to start examining myself and challenge you to do the same. After all, we can rest when we die! :)
1) God, what can I do better for you?
2) God, what are other things I can do for you?
3) Am I giving you 100 or 200?
